Understanding Minimalist Design Principles for Small Spaces

Minimalism, at its core, is about intentional living and removing clutter. In the context of furniture, this translates to choosing pieces that are functional, visually uncluttered, and serve a clear purpose. For small home offices, this approach is particularly crucial. Key elements of minimalist design for small spaces include:

  • Clean lines and simple shapes: Avoid ornate detailing or overly complex designs. Straight lines and simple geometric shapes create a sense of spaciousness.
  • Neutral color palettes: Stick to a limited color scheme, primarily using neutral tones like whites, grays, and beiges. These colors help to create a sense of calm and openness.
  • Multi-functional furniture: Opt for pieces that serve multiple purposes, such as a desk with built-in drawers or a storage ottoman that doubles as seating.
  • Hidden storage: Maximize storage space by utilizing drawers, cabinets, and shelving units that are integrated seamlessly into the design.
  • Decluttering regularly: A key aspect of maintaining a minimalist aesthetic is regularly decluttering your workspace. Keep only essential items on your desk and in your immediate vicinity.

Choosing the Right Minimalist Writing Desk

The writing desk is the centerpiece of any home office. When choosing a minimalist desk for a small space, consider the following factors:

Desk Size and Shape

Opt for a desk that’s appropriately sized for your needs and the available space. A smaller, floating desk or a wall-mounted desk can save valuable floor space. Consider the shape – a rectangular desk is a classic choice, while a corner desk can maximize space utilization in a corner office. A narrow console table can also serve as a minimalist desk, especially if space is extremely limited.

The material of your desk significantly impacts its aesthetic and durability. Popular minimalist choices include:

  • Wood: Offers a natural, warm aesthetic. Light-colored woods like ash or maple create a brighter feel.
  • Metal: Provides a sleek, modern look. Steel or aluminum desks are durable and easy to clean.
  • Glass: Creates a sense of spaciousness and is easy to clean. However, it can be less durable than wood or metal.
  • Laminate: A budget-friendly option that offers a variety of styles and colors. Choose a high-quality laminate for better durability.

Desk Features

Consider essential features such as:

  • Drawers: Built-in drawers provide convenient storage for stationery, files, and other office essentials.
  • Cable management: Choose a desk with cable management features to keep wires organized and out of sight.
  • Adjustable height: An adjustable height desk can improve posture and comfort, particularly if you spend long hours working at your desk.

Essential Minimalist Furniture for Your Small Home Office

Beyond the desk, several other pieces of furniture can enhance your minimalist home office:

Minimalist Office Chair

Choose an ergonomic chair that’s comfortable and supports good posture. A simple, streamlined design in a neutral color will complement your minimalist desk.

Storage Solutions

Strategic storage is crucial for maintaining a clutter-free workspace. Consider:

  • Filing cabinets: A slim, vertical filing cabinet can store important documents without taking up too much floor space.
  • Bookshelves: A wall-mounted bookshelf or a narrow bookshelf can store books and office supplies.
  • Storage baskets: Use stylish storage baskets to organize stationery and other small items.

Lighting

Good lighting is essential for productivity and eye health. A simple desk lamp or a minimalist pendant light can provide adequate illumination.

Accessorizing Your Minimalist Home Office

While minimalism is about simplicity, a few carefully chosen accessories can personalize your workspace. Consider:

  • A simple desk organizer: Keep your pens, pencils, and other stationery items neatly organized.
  • A small potted plant: Adds a touch of life and color to your workspace.
  • Inspirational artwork: A single piece of minimalist artwork can add personality without overwhelming the space.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s): Minimalist Writing Desk Furniture For Small Home Offices

  • Q: What is the best size desk for a small home office? A: The ideal desk size depends on your needs and available space. A desk that’s 48 inches wide by 24 inches deep is a good starting point for most people, but smaller desks are available.
  • Q: What materials are best for a minimalist desk? A: Wood, metal, glass, and laminate are all popular choices for minimalist desks. The best material will depend on your personal preferences and budget.
  • Q: How can I maximize storage in a small home office? A: Utilize vertical space with shelves and filing cabinets. Use drawers and hidden storage solutions in your desk and other furniture. Consider multi-functional furniture that incorporates storage.
  • Q: What is the best way to organize a minimalist home office? A: Regularly declutter your workspace, keeping only essential items. Use storage solutions to keep everything organized and out of sight. Prioritize functionality and ease of access.
